Wallis and Futuna - Mangosteens, Guavas and Mangoes Yield
Since 2014, Wallis and Futuna Mangosteens, Guavas and Mangoes Yield fell by 0.4% year on year. With 43,502 Hectograms Per Hectare in 2019, the country was ranked number 84 comparing other countries in Mangosteens, Guavas and Mangoes Yield. Wallis and Futuna is overtaken by Grenada, which was number 83 with 43,584 Hectograms Per Hectare and is followed by Benin at 43,067 Hectograms Per Hectare. Guyana ranked the highest with 429,235 Hectograms Per Hectare in 2019, an increase of 7.6% compared to 2018. Samoa, Malawi and Israel respectively ranked number 2, 3 and 4 in this ranking. Rwanda recorded the best 5 years average growth at +15.9% per year, while Madagascar recorded the worst performance at -14.4% per year.
